Beschreibung

Get ready to plunge into the depths of terror with "This book is a compilation of 7 scary short stories of the macabre." As you open its pages, be prepared for heart-pounding suspense and bone-chilling horror that will send shivers down your spine. Each story within this collection brings forth a unique nightmare, weaving its way through the darkest recesses of your imagination. Brace yourself for an electrifying journey into the shadows where malevolent entities lurk in every corner and unspeakable horrors await around each twisted turn. With each tale, expect to be gripped by an unrelenting sense of dread that will leave you trembling long after you have reluctantly turned off the lights. Sleepless nights lie ahead as these haunting tales unfold before your eyes, unveiling dark secrets better left buried beneath layers of forgotten time and terrifying legends whispered under hushed breaths at midnight gatherings. So gather your courage, dear reader, because once you step into this world wrought with chilling horror, there is no turning back - surrender yourself to these seven eerie adventures that wait within this bewitching compilation

Portrait

Mortaza Tokhy is a child author with an astounding gift; At the tender age of twelve, he holds the title of the youngest published horror fiction author. With astonishing skill and creativity, Mortaza has crafted diabolically thrilling tales of paranormal, sci-fi and horror that captivates readers around the world. His razor sharp writing leaves many mouths agape in disbelief that someone so young could be capable of such works.
